Check the drying care guidelines within the mark of each attire thing. This will assist you with abstaining from contracting, liquefying, or harming textures that are not intended to dry under extraordinary warmth. Most attire things, and even family textures like drapes, will have a tag sew onto them giving prescribed washing and drying directions. A few things will prescribe tumble drying a thing with low warmth, and others may explicitly say to not tumble dry (Source)

In the event that conceivable, clear out the build-up from the cushion channel after each utilization. Permitting the build-up to develop blocks your dryer from moving air around proficiently. 

You can either expel the build-up with your hands (which will evacuate the greater part of the build-up) or utilize a vacuum cleaner on the off chance that you need to get to the cushion that is in difficulty to arrive at places. A few dryers additionally have a launderable cushion channel which can be opened up for simple cleaning under running water.

Let fragile apparel things air-dry to abstain from harming them. Sensitive textures can be harmed after some time on the off chance that they rub against catches or harsh material like denim in the dryer. To expand the life of sensitive pieces of clothing, make some room in a storage room to drape garments to air-dry, or put resources into a drying rack.

Decrease static stick by putting a dryer sheet into the dryer with the wet garments. The dry air within the pivoting metal drum makes static development between the textures as they rub together. Dryer sheets will likewise mellow harsh textures, so keep a case of them by or on your dryer so you remember to utilize one. At the point when the heap of clothing is done, simply discard the sheet as the impacts are just useful for 1 use.
